  1. Apr 25, 2024 · Steve Prefontaine was a long-distance runner who is often regarded as one of the most important figures in American running, known for both his athletic prowess and celebrity. At his untimely death in 1975, Prefontaine held every American record between 2,000 and 10,000 meters.

  3. Prefontaine is a 1997 American biographical film chronicling the life of the American long-distance runner Steve Prefontaine and his death at age 24. Jared Leto plays the title character and R. Lee Ermey plays Bill Bowerman. The film was written by Steve James and Eugene Corr, and directed by James.

  7. Steve Prefontaine is likely the most legendary American distance runner, not just for his feats on the track, but his manner of winning, and his early, tragic death. He came to the fore as a high school distance runner in Coos Bay, Oregon, where he broke the 2-mile high school record with 8:41.5.
